Durability and Hardness Variables
While both lab-grown and extracted diamonds possess remarkable longevity, their firmness continues to be a specifying particular that emphasizes their viability for day-to-day wear. Rubies are rated a 10 on the Mohs scale of mineral hardness, making them the hardest natural product recognized (lab grown diamond engagement rings). This particular warranties that both kinds of rubies withstand scratching and maintain their luster in time. Lab-grown diamonds, produced under controlled problems, exhibit the very same hardness and physical homes as their extracted counterparts. Because of this, they provide a resistant and appealing choice for engagement rings. Customers can confidently pick either kind, understanding that both provide long-lasting top quality. Just How Are Lab-Grown Diamonds Produced in a Research laboratory?
Lab-grown diamonds are produced making use of 2 primary methods: High Stress Heat (HPHT) simulates natural Diamond formation problems, while Chemical Vapor Deposition (CVD) uses gas to precipitate carbon onto a substrate, developing rubies layer by layer.
Do Lab-Grown Rubies Hold Their Worth In Time?
Lab-grown rubies generally do not hold their worth as well as all-natural diamonds. Market changes and customer assumptions affect resale prices, bring about lower long-term value retention for lab-grown options compared to their all-natural equivalents.
